Now, about wagering. Nobody loves it, but it’s part of the deal. Tesor Casino uses “Standard Wagering” for most bonuses, and it’s mainly designed for slots. The FAQ explains which games are eligible if you’re unsure. Basically, you’ve got “real money” and “bonus money.” Your bonus money has requirements you need to meet before it turns into real cash you can withdraw. The important thing I learned is that your real money gets used first. If you win while playing with real money, those winnings go straight back to your real balance. Your bonus only starts wagering once your real cash is gone. To convert that bonus, you just need to place bets totaling X times the bonus amount. All your bets count, win or lose, which is fair. If you change your mind, you can cancel a bonus, but it will take the bonus funds and any winnings with it, so be sure you want to do that.

Contribution rates are pretty standard: slots count 100%, Bonus Buy games are 50%, Live games are 10%, and Instant Win games are 5%. So, if you’re trying to clear a bonus, slots are definitely your best bet for speed. You can manage all your active bonuses right in the “Bonuses” section, which keeps things organized.

Climbing the Ranks: The VIP & Loyalty Program

Okay, this is pretty cool. Tesor Casino has a pirate-themed loyalty program, which, let’s be real, is a fun idea. You start as a “Deckhand” and work your way up through “Buccaneer,” “First Mate,” “Captain,” “Commodore,” and then the ultimate, “Legend of the Seas.” I’m a sucker for a good theme, and this one makes you want to climb the ladder, or plank, I guess.

It’s open to all registered players from day one, which is nice. You don’t have to be a high roller to start earning points. You get 1 loyalty point for every €20 you wager. So, the more you play, the more points you rack up. They measure your level over a “rolling 60-day period” which means they reward consistent activity. That’s fair.

The levels require different amounts of loyalty points (LP)

  • Deckhand: 0–79 LP
  • Buccaneer: 80–549 LP
  • First Mate: 550–1,999 LP
  • Captain: 2,000–6,999 LP
  • Commodore: 7,000–199,999 LP
  • Legend of the Seas: 200,000 LP

You also need “Deposit points” (DP) for some of the higher ranks. For instance, to be a Captain, you need 100 DP, a Commodore needs 1,500 DP, and a Legend of the Seas needs a whopping 30,000 DP. That’s a lot of deposits, but it means serious commitment to the casino. My current goal is just getting to First Mate, honestly.

The rewards for climbing are pretty sweet. As a Deckhand, you get 85 free spins. Buccaneer gets you a €33 bonus. First Mate gets €95. Captain gets a nice €750 bonus. Commodore is €6,100, and if you hit Legend of the Seas, you’re looking at a €10,000 bonus! That’s a serious incentive to keep playing. Plus, VIP perks include weekly reloads, access to the Spin Wheel, birthday rewards (who doesn’t love those?), and weekly cashback. Higher ranks even get cashback boosters, increased withdrawal limits, exclusive VIP bonuses, priority withdrawal processing, and a dedicated VIP manager. Imagine having your own manager!

The cashback booster examples are pretty good too: First Mate gets 1% extra cashback, Captain gets 2%, Commodore gets 4%, and Legend of the Seas gets 5%. That adds up over time. And the weekly reload bonuses get better as you go up too. As a Deckhand, you get 50% up to €50 with a x40 wager. But as a Legend of the Seas, you get 100% up to €1,000 with only an x5 wager! That’s a massive difference. Loyalty points contribute 100% for slots, casino originals, live roulette, live blackjack, and instant win games, which is great if those are your go-to games. For weekly cashback, you need a deposit sum of €20 or above, and it can reach up to 25% of your previous week’s deposits, with a maximum of €1,250.
